Game 10 Preview: Kalamazoo at Iowa

Hearts host K-Wings for 1st time, postgame skate pres. by Family Dental Center

Coralville, Iowa – The Iowa Heartlanders (2-6-1-0, 5 pts.) look for their second consecutive win and host the division foe Kalamazoo Wings (4-3-0-0, 8 pts.) Sunday at 3:00 p.m. Today’s game features a postgame skate at the Heartlanders, pres. by Family Dental Center.Iowa defeated the Indy Fuel, 5-3, Friday at Xtream Arena thanks to leadership contributions. Captain Kris Bennett scored his second career multi-goal game and Iowa scored three times in the second to up-end Indy. Ryan Kuffner assisted on Bennett’s second goal, the game-winning strike, which was a short-handed goal at 19:00 of the second that gave Iowa a 4-3 edge. Cole Stallard potted his first goal of the season. Kaid Oliver registered two points, including the first goal of his pro career. Trevin Kozlowski made 26 saves for his first professional victory.The Heartlanders and K-Wings are meeting for the first of ten games, five of which will be here at Xtream Arena.Kalamazoo played Ft. Wayne Saturday and won, 7-2, behind a three-point effort from Max Humitz (2g).Iowa visits Toledo in the team’s next games on Fri., Nov. 19 and Sat., Nov. 20 (6:15 p.m. puck drops). The Heartlanders complete the road trip at Ft. Wayne on Sun., Nov. 21 at 4:00 p.m.The Heartlanders are next at home for another Staybridge Suites home stand Nov. 24, Nov. 26 and Nov. 27. NHL Affiliates: Iowa Heartlanders (Minnesota Wild/Iowa Wild) | Kalamazoo Wings (Columbus Blue Jackets/Cleveland MonstersStorylines:- Ryan Kuffner reunited with Kris Bennett and the two picked up where they left off from the opening weekend. Kuffner passed to Bennett for the game-winning goal Friday vs. Indy and has assisted three of Bennett’s five goals this campaign.- Iowa had the most power-play attempts in team history Friday (7). The Fuel also had 7 attempts, the most the Heartlanders have given up to an opponent.- Kaid Oliver netted two points Friday and has three multi-point games. He was one of four Iowa players with multiple points Friday.- The Kalamazoo Wings have been in the ECHL since 2009. They’ve been affiliates to nine NHL teams and ten AHL in their 13 years. They are now ECHL affiliates of the AHL’s Cleveland Monsters and NHL’s Columbus Blue Jackets. Prior to the ECHL, the Wings played in the UHL and IHL from 2000-09. Nick Bootland has been the Head Coach of the K-Wings since they joined the ECHL. Bootland is 11 games shy of becoming the sixth ECHL Head Coach to reach 800 games. Entering the weekend, Bootland was seventh in league history with 403 wins.
